Canva: Free Cloud-Based Graphic Design Tool for Social Media

Sandy Chiu
3 min readSep 1, 2020

Do you really need to pay Adobe Creative Cloud membership for Photoshop or other tools? As a beginner or non-designer, this free tool might just be what you need to promote your social media account.

Not just it’s free, there’re no design skills required. All you need is your creativity.

Who is it for

  • You are new to design.
  • You want to save money from hiring a designer.
  • You just want a simple tool to quickly validate your ideas.

What can you create

Logo

There’s a wide category of templates to choose from depending on your brand or business, such as fashion, education, sport or computer.

Make your own YouTube intro or thumbnail

Want one of those cool animations for your YouTube channel? Canva’s got you covered.

Social media post

Secrets to beautiful images on Instagram, Facebook, Twitter, or Pinterest. If you’re a blogger, it is crucial to increase attractions with a good cover photo for your posts.

Use photo collage to make a digital Moodboard

Needs inspirations before setting the tone for your next design? It is very easy to do.

There are so many things you can do with Canva, other than what I included above you can also use it to make presentation, poster, website, book cover, business card, invitation, etc.

Other than benefit from their extensive options of templates, you can also create your own designs from scratch.

How to use it

Here’s a quick example of how you may create a quotes Instagram post:

  1. Pick a template you like:

2. Change the text, colour, or background images to customise it for your brand:

3. Download:

Depends on the template you selected, you may be charged a fee (as small as £0.99 for each premium image). To avoid the charges, you could replace it from a selection of free photos or upload your own.

Pricing

For a personal project, free membership should be sufficient. There are other features that will only be available for Pro (from £8.99 per user monthly) or Enterprise (from £24.00 per user monthly) membership.
